Two errors:
A shooter can not get M1 thumb loading the rifle.
The bolt should be ridden halfway closed before letting it fly home single loading to avoid a slam fire. The friction of the bolt on the rounds in the magazine slow it's travel in normal operation.Phillip McGregor (OFC)

I caught the 'M1 Thumb while loading' comment too but it's a common misconception that's been out there for a long time so I'll cut him some slack. I also disagree with his statement that M1 disassembly is complicated. I find it very easy to take apart; especially the trigger assembly. Bolt disassembly can be accomplished without removal from the rifle which is my preferred method. I also feel that the safety is one of the best. Otherwise, it's an informative video that entertains as well.Last edited by Rock; 09-03-2016, 11:06.Comment
